docker安装mysql
时间: 2023-05-08 15:56:10 浏览: 212
在docker中安装mysql详解
在Docker中安装MySQL非常方便,只需要按照以下步骤进行操作即可:
1.首先,在主机上安装Docker。安装完成后,使用以下命令检查是否安装成功:
```
docker version
```
2.接下来,从Docker Hub中下载MySQL映像。您可以使用以下命令:
```
docker pull mysql
```
此命令将下载最新版本的MySQL映像。如果需要下载特定版本,则可以使用以下命令:
```
docker pull mysql:tag
```
其中tag是您需要下载的MySQL版本的标记。
3.接下来,在容器中启动MySQL数据库。使用以下命令进行操作:
```
docker run --name mysql -e MYSQL_ROOT_PASSWORD=yourpassword -d mysql:latest
```
该命令将启动一个名为“mysql”的容器,并在其中设置了一个名为“yourpassword”的根密码。
4.现在,您可以使用以下命令进入MySQL容器并使用mysql命令行工具:
```
docker exec -it mysql bash
mysql -u root -p
```
使用上述命令将会进入容器,使用mysql命令行工具并输入root用户的密码(在上一步命令中设置)。
5.最后,您可以在容器中创建、删除、修改数据库和表格等操作。如果您需要保存这些更改,请记得导出MySQL容器中的数据。您可以使用以下命令导出MySQL容器数据:
```
docker exec mysql sh -c 'exec mysqldump --all-databases -u root -p"$MYSQL_ROOT_PASSWORD"' > /path/to/file.sql
```
以上是在Docker中安装MySQL的步骤。如果您需要重新启动MySQL容器,请使用以下命令:
```
docker start mysql
```
阅读全文